1044 -Access denied for user 'root'@'%' to database 'xg'
时间: 2023-12-30 21:24:38 浏览: 55
链路状态入口-linux连接mysql报错:access denied for user ‘root’@‘localhost’(using password: yes)的解决方法
根据你提供的引用内容,你遇到的问题是1044 - Access denied for user 'root'@'%' to database 'xg'。这个错误通常是由于用户'root'没有访问数据库'xg'的权限导致的。解决这个问题的方法是通过更新用户的密码来授予用户访问数据库的权限。
你可以使用以下SQL语句来更新用户的密码:
```sql
UPDATE user SET password = password('Xg@2015Sh') WHERE user = 'root';
```
这将把用户'root'的密码更新为'Xg@2015Sh'。更新密码后,用户'root'应该能够访问数据库'xg'了。
阅读全文